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[smarty] Wyświetlanie co drugiego wyniku w pętli
user123
post
Post #1





Grupa: Zarejestrowani
Postów: 231
Pomógł: 2
Dołączył: 2.08.2006
Skąd: Poznań

Ostrzeżenie: (10%)
X----


Witam,

w jakis sposób za pomocą pętli w smartach stworzyć dwie kolumny. Zademonstruje to na przykładzie:

  1. {foreach from=$cos item=bbb key=i}
  2. <tr>
  3. </tr>
  4. {/foreach}


w jakis sposób wywołać smarty aby stworzyć dwie kolumny róznych danych.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
karolrynio
post
Post #2





Grupa: Zarejestrowani
Postów: 144
Pomógł: 25
Dołączył: 2.02.2009

Ostrzeżenie: (0%)
-----


Możesz spróbować czegoś takiego:
Kod
<table>
{foreach from=$cos item=bbb key=i name="lalal"}
{if $smarty.foreach.lalal.iteration%2==1}
<tr>
{/if}
<td>{$??}</td>
{if $smarty.foreach.lalal.iteration%2==0 || $smarty.foreach.lalal.last}
</tr>
{/if}
{/foreach}
</table>
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 27.12.2025 - 02:53